PIB Insulation: What You Need to Know

PIB insulation, also known as polyisobutene or polyisobutylene insulation, is a type of weatherproof cladding that is used to protect pipes, ducts, tanks, and other equipment from corrosion, moisture, and UV rays.

PIB insulation is flexible, durable, and resistant to chemicals, oils, and acids. It can withstand temperatures ranging from -40°C to 120°C and has excellent thermal and acoustic properties. PIB insulation is widely used in various industries, such as HVAC, refrigeration, petrochemical, marine, and power generation.

Benefits of PIB Insulation

PIB InsulationPIB insulation offers many advantages over other types of insulation, such as:

  • Weatherproofing: PIB insulation forms a seamless and watertight barrier that prevents water ingress, condensation, and frost damage. It also protects the underlying surface from UV degradation, oxidation, and fungal growth.
  • Corrosion protection: PIB insulation prevents corrosion and rusting of metal pipes and ducts by isolating them from the external environment. It also resists chemical attacks from acids, alkalis, and salts.
  • Thermal efficiency: PIB insulation reduces heat loss and improves energy efficiency by maintaining a constant temperature of the insulated system. It also prevents overheating and fire hazards by providing a low flammability rating.
  • Noise reduction: PIB insulation absorbs sound and reduces noise transmission by up to 25 dB. It also dampens vibrations and mechanical stresses that can cause fatigue and failure of the insulated system.
  • Flexibility and durability: PIB insulation is easy to install and conforms to any shape and size of the insulated system. It can also withstand mechanical damage, abrasion, and punctures. It has a long service life and requires minimal maintenance.

Features of PIB Insulation

PIB insulation is available in different forms, such as:

  • Sheets: PIB insulation sheets are pre-cut and ready to use. They are ideal for flat or curved surfaces, such as tanks, vessels, and walls. They come in various thicknesses, widths, and lengths, and can be joined together with adhesive tape or heat welding.
  • Rolls: PIB insulation rolls are continuous and can be cut to the required size. They are suitable for wrapping around pipes, ducts, and cables. They come in various diameters, widths, and lengths, and can be secured with clips or bands.
  • Tapes: PIB insulation tapes are self-adhesive and can be applied to joints, seams, and corners. They are used to seal gaps, cracks, and holes, and to repair damaged areas. They come in various widths and lengths and can be overlapped or stretched to fit.

Applications of PIB Insulation

PIB insulation can be used for a wide range of applications, such as:

  • HVAC: PIB insulation can be used to insulate he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ems, such as boilers, chillers, heat exchangers, air handlers, and ducts. It can improve the performance and efficiency of the HVAC system and reduce the risk of condensation and mould growth.
  • Refrigeration: PIB insulation can be used to insulate refrigeration systems, such as cold rooms, freezers, ice machines, and refrigerated trucks. It can prevent heat gain and maintain the desired temperature of the refrigerated system and the stored products.
  • Petrochemical: PIB insulation can be used to insulate petrochemical systems, such as pipelines, valves, flanges, and fittings. It can protect the petrochemical system from corrosion, fire, and explosion, and prevent product loss and environmental damage.
  • Marine: PIB insulation can be used to insulate marine systems, such as ships, offshore platforms, and submarines. It can withstand harsh weather conditions, saltwater exposure, and marine growth, and provide thermal and acoustic insulation for the marine system and the crew.
  • Power generation: PIB insulation can be used to insulate power generation systems, such as generators, transformers, and switchgear. It can prevent electrical faults, short circuits, and power outages, and enhance the safety and reliability of the power generation system.

Frequently Asked Questions 

Q: What is PIB insulation and how does it work?

A: PIB insulation, or polyisobutylene insulation, is a type of weatherproof insulation cladding commonly used for pipework and ventilation ductwork. It is a high molecular weight polyisobutylene material that offers outstanding properties over a wide temperature range, making it an ideal waterproofing membrane for pipework and ventilation systems.

Q: What are the key properties of PIB insulation?

A: PIB insulation has outstanding properties such as weatherproofing, flexibility, and resistance to wide temperature ranges. It is also known for its high molecular weight and is preferred by many contractors for its ease of use and effectiveness in providing insulation.

Q: Where can PIB insulation be used?

A: PIB insulation is commonly used in various industrial settings such as oil refineries, chemical works, and power stations. It is also suitable for waterproofing membranes for pipework and ventilation ductwork, making it a versatile choice for insulation requirements.

Q: What are the dimensions of PIB insulation sheets?

A: PIB insulation sheets are typically available in dimensions of 1m x 15m, providing a convenient size for installation and covering insulation requirements.

Q: How is PIB insulation installed?

A: PIB insulation can be installed using welding agents and is known for its ease of installation. It can be applied to various surfaces, providing effective insulation in place.
